Output 6c8a6a6f2bbe0fca481e1e1b5d0e289524cfd7bec0ca8ea9755be2e47a66233d:0

value
834083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14c8b908693b401397600111b601ee368178a001 OP_EQUAL
address
33autquFEbWUYUcVfYiBuvtg2rtWEZVD6t
transaction
6c8a6a6f2bbe0fca481e1e1b5d0e289524cfd7bec0ca8ea9755be2e47a66233d
confirmations
431756
spent
true